Key Bible Verses About Trusting in God’s Plan
Let’s dive into some of the most impactful biblical verses that highlight the importance of trusting in God’s purpose:
1. Proverbs 3:5-6
“Trust in the LORD with all your heart and lean not on your own understanding; in all your ways submit to Him, and He will make your paths straight.”
This verse teaches us the importance of fully committing to God’s will, even when we can't see the larger picture. By leaning on Him rather than our limited understanding, we receive guidance directly to our intended path.
2. Jeremiah 29:11
“For I know the plans I have for you,” declares the LORD, “plans to prosper you and not to harm you, plans to give you hope and a future.”
God’s assurance to His people emphasizes His loving intentions. This verse reassures believers that even in challenging times, there is hope, and a brighter future lies ahead.
3. Psalm 37:5
“Commit your way to the LORD; trust in Him and He will do this.”
Here, we see the divine link between our commitment to God and His faithfulness in responding to those commitments. It encourages us to take the first step by handing over our plans to Him.
4. Romans 8:28
“And we know that in all things God works for the good of those who love Him, who have been called according to his purpose.”
This verse encapsulates God's promise that no matter how difficult our current situation may be, it can ultimately lead to good, provided we remain faithful to Him.
5. Isaiah 55:8-9
“For my thoughts are not your thoughts, neither are your ways my ways,” declares the LORD. “As the heavens are higher than the earth, so are my ways higher than your ways and my thoughts than your thoughts.”
This powerful reminder reinforces that God's perspective transcends our limited human understanding. Trusting in His plan requires submission to His greater wisdom.
How to Cultivate Trust in God’s Plan
1. Prayer and Reflection
- Daily Conversations: Engage in regular prayer to discuss your worries with God.
- Meditation: Reflect on specific scriptures to deepen your understanding and trust.
2. Study Scriptures
- Daily Devotionals: Dedicate time to read and understand the context of Bible verses about trust.
- Join a Study Group: Engage with fellow believers to share insights and strengthen faith collectively.
3. Practice Gratitude
- Thankfulness Journals: Write down daily blessings as a reminder of God’s past faithfulness.
- Praise in Trials: Acknowledge God during challenges, recognizing His role in your life.
